The basic version is limited to 16 factory chords (the most popular according the info), which can make it a bit limiting. You won't however find any better guitar sim/instrument on the AppStore, this thing is really expressive and follows how you play it with different articulations, fret noises, "mutes" etc. This app is a good deal at full price (10 bucks).
